Franklin County and Grant County are counties in Arkansas.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

Grant County has the higher population (18,111 vs 17,220 in Franklin County). Grant County has the higher median household income ($72,512 vs $51,919 in Franklin County). Grant County has the higher median home value ($154,500 vs $118,800 in Franklin County).
